1. Barrier: complexity

Solution: Simplify

Since our childhood, we tend to make all things complex. It is a habit that affects how we live and think today. There are many simple things in life that we consider to be challenging, and we emotionally put all effort into solving them. But what do we think about them as something quick and simple?

A huge part of our happiness depends on our point of view. The more difficult we think, the more difficult the solution will be. Try to simplify your life in everything. You may start with basic things like waking up early, preparing breakfast, going to work or something that bothers you a little bit.

2. Barrier: a breakneck speed

Solution: Take a pause

We all live in a highly digital fast-speed world where people are constantly trying to become successful and adults as soon as possible. But in reality, we all have our own speed or life and do not need to move at the same speed as others.

The goal of achieving things at an immense speed significantly affects our happiness. This is because modern kids always see how their peers became millionaires at 18. And they also want to achieve the same, and we set too high goals without thinking about our mental health.

The same happens with studying and overworking, where everyone goes crazy even about one day of relaxing and chilling. This is why it is vital to maintain a healthy life-work balance and give you a break when the body needs it. This will help you not only achieve happiness but also make you more productive after relaxing.

3. Barrier: negativity

Solution: Think positively

Some people may find this point a bit of an exaggeration. But in reality, negative thoughts become a habit of thinking all the time negatively and affect our overall mental health and ability to cope with stress. How you see things and the way you experience issues you face are strongly linked, making it essential to adopt a positive look at everything.

Experts believe that we interact with the world around us through the senses and mind. If you can find a way to think positively, it will make it easier for you to go through life challenges.

4. Barrier: Suppressing sadness

Solution: Feel your emotions 

Having a positive outlook doesn’t mean you need to suppress your emotions. However, most people believe that when they suppress sadness, it will go away quicker. In reality, you need to go through the complete spectrum of your emotions and let yourself struggle when you need it.

When your mental health problems start to affect your physical health, you can take one or few days and treat yourself like you are psychically ill. Our bodies will consider it like a pause and quicker recharge. It is worth noting that happiness is impossible without sadness. You need to learn how to express your emotions in a healthy way and take care of yourself when it is required.

5 Barrier: Staying alone

Solution: Connect with others

Social networks are vital for our happiness. So if you are staying alone in your life and try to cope with all life problems alone, it won’t work out for a long time without burning out. However, it is also vital to create a proper network around you. As if you are around people who also always think negatively and can’t support you – it will be hard for you to think otherwise.

The more self-focused you are, the more your world closes in. So try to start with small talks, find new friends and ask family for help or support. Make people around you happy, and you will absorb this point of view every day.
